Do these Double Couple socks provide true 20–30 mmHg compression?
The listing describes 20–30 mmHg graduated compression, but review feedback is mixed. Some buyers report noticeable, effective compression, while others say the socks feel similar to lower-compression alternatives or do not provide the pressure expected. The effectiveness score of 74 suggests practical usefulness, not confirmation that the stated compression level is consistent for every user.

What are the main limitations of Double Couple Copper Compression Socks?
The main issues are mixed compression, fit, and durability feedback. Some reviewers found the socks too tight or too mild for the stated rating, and some reported holes after repeated washing. Evidence quality is also limited at 54: customer experiences do not verify the listing’s copper-related claims, and warranty or support details are not clearly provided.

Do the copper-related claims have strong evidence?
No strong product-specific evidence is supplied for the copper-related claims. The evidence quality score is 54, indicating limited available support rather than confirmed health benefit. The available reviews can describe personal experiences with comfort or support, but they should not be treated as scientific proof that copper fibers improve circulation or deliver medical outcomes.
